Can I take a bus with my dog in Saint Petersburg? - in detail
In Saint Petersburg, the regulations regarding pets on public transportation, including buses, are designed to ensure the comfort and safety of all passengers. Understanding these rules is essential for pet owners who wish to travel with their dogs.
Firstly, it is important to note that small dogs, typically those that can be comfortably carried in a pet carrier or bag, are generally allowed on buses. These carriers should be clean, well-ventilated, and secure to prevent any accidents or escapes. The carrier must be placed on the floor or in the designated area for personal items, ensuring it does not obstruct the aisle or other passengers.
For larger dogs, the rules are more stringent. Generally, large dogs are not permitted on public buses in Saint Petersburg. This policy is in place to maintain a comfortable and safe environment for all passengers, as larger dogs may pose a risk of causing discomfort or accidents. However, there are exceptions for service dogs, which are trained to assist individuals with disabilities. Service dogs are allowed on buses regardless of their size, provided they are properly trained and under the control of their handler.
It is also crucial to follow general etiquette when traveling with a pet. Dogs should be well-behaved and under the owner's control at all times. Owners are responsible for cleaning up after their pets and ensuring that the pet does not disturb other passengers. Failure to comply with these regulations may result in being asked to leave the bus or face other penalties.
In summary, small dogs in carriers are typically allowed on buses in Saint Petersburg, while larger dogs are generally not permitted, except for service dogs. Pet owners should always check the latest regulations and ensure their pets are well-behaved and properly contained to avoid any issues during their journey.
